excel公式后怎么复制粘贴的内容不显示
作者:百问excel教程网
|
313人看过
发布时间:2026-03-03 23:43:52
当您在Excel中复制包含公式的单元格并粘贴后,发现没有显示预期的数值或内容,这通常是因为粘贴时保留了原始公式的引用或格式,而非其计算结果。要解决“excel公式后怎么复制粘贴的内容不显示”的问题,核心在于使用“选择性粘贴”功能中的“数值”选项,或者调整单元格的显示格式,确保粘贴的是公式运算后的静态结果,而非公式本身。
在日常使用Excel处理数据时,我们经常会遇到一个看似简单却令人困惑的操作:当您精心设计了一个公式,计算出所需的结果后,试图将这个结果复制到其他位置或另一个工作表时,粘贴出来的内容却不是您想要的数字或文本,有时甚至是空白或错误信息。这个问题,即“excel公式后怎么复制粘贴的内容不显示”,确实会让工作效率大打折扣,甚至影响数据的准确性。今天,作为一名资深的网站编辑,我将为您深入剖析这一现象背后的多种原因,并提供一套完整、实用且专业的解决方案,帮助您彻底掌握Excel中复制粘贴的精髓。
为什么复制了公式,粘贴后却不显示内容? 首先,我们需要理解Excel中公式的本质。公式不是一个静态的值,而是一个动态的计算指令,例如“=A1+B1”。当您使用常规的复制(快捷键Ctrl+C)和粘贴(Ctrl+V)操作时,Excel默认复制的是这个“指令”本身以及其单元格格式。如果您将公式粘贴到一个新的位置,比如C1单元格,Excel会智能地(有时也可能不那么智能地)调整公式中的单元格引用。例如,原来的“=A1+B1”粘贴到C1后,可能会变成“=B1+C1”,这取决于您的粘贴方式。如果目标位置的引用单元格恰好没有数据或数据格式不匹配,那么公式计算的结果就可能显示为0、错误值(如N/A、VALUE!),或者因为单元格被设置为特定格式(如自定义格式为“;;;”,即不显示任何内容)而看起来是空白的。这就是导致“excel公式后怎么复制粘贴的内容不显示”最常见的情形之一。 其次,单元格的显示格式扮演了关键角色。假设一个单元格通过公式计算出了数值“123”,但该单元格的数字格式被设置为“文本”,那么它可能仍然显示为公式字符串“=A1+B1”本身,而不是计算结果“123”。同样,如果单元格的自定义格式被设置为在特定条件下隐藏数值(例如,格式代码为“[红色][<0]0;[蓝色][>100]0;;”,当数值不符合条件时可能不显示),那么即使公式计算正确,您也可能看不到任何内容。这种格式层面的“隐身术”常常被使用者忽略。 再者,粘贴选项的选择直接决定了最终呈现的内容。Excel的粘贴板功能非常强大,提供了多达十几种粘贴选项。如果您直接按Ctrl+V,使用的是“全部粘贴”的默认行为,这会将原始单元格的一切——包括公式、格式、批注、数据验证等——都搬运到新位置。如果您的需求仅仅是那个最终的计算结果,那么这种“全盘复制”显然不是最佳选择,因为它可能在新环境中引发引用错误或格式冲突,从而导致显示异常。 那么,如何确保复制粘贴后显示的是我们想要的“值”呢?最核心、最有效的方法是使用“选择性粘贴”功能。操作步骤如下:首先,选中包含公式的单元格并复制(Ctrl+C)。然后,右键点击目标单元格,在弹出菜单中找到“选择性粘贴”,或者点击“开始”选项卡下“粘贴板”区域中“粘贴”按钮下方的小箭头,展开粘贴选项。在弹出的选项中,选择“数值”(通常显示为“123”图标)。这个操作会将公式的计算结果以静态数值的形式粘贴到目标位置,彻底切断与原公式的动态链接。之后,无论原数据如何变化,粘贴过来的数值都不会再改变,并且会正常显示。 除了使用鼠标操作,快捷键能极大提升效率。在复制源单元格后,移动到目标单元格,按下快捷键“Alt+E, S, V”(这是旧版Excel的经典序列,在某些版本中依然有效),或者更通用的“Ctrl+Alt+V”,这会直接打开“选择性粘贴”对话框,然后按“V”键选择“数值”,最后按回车确认。熟练掌握这些快捷键,能让您的数据处理速度飞升。 如果“选择性粘贴数值”后仍然不显示,我们就需要检查目标单元格的格式了。请右键点击目标单元格,选择“设置单元格格式”(或按Ctrl+1)。在“数字”选项卡下,确认分类是否为“常规”、“数值”或“会计专用”等能够正常显示数字的格式,而不是“文本”或某些特殊的自定义格式。将其改为“常规”,通常就能让隐藏的数值“现身”。 有时候,问题可能出在公式本身返回了空字符串。例如,公式可能是“=IF(A1>10, A1, "")”,当条件不满足时,公式结果就是一个长度为零的文本("")。复制这样的结果并粘贴后,单元格看起来就是空的,但实际上它包含了一个不可见的空文本字符。要区分真正的空白单元格和包含空文本的单元格,可以使用“LEN”函数来检查单元格内容的长度。处理这种情况,可能需要在源公式中进行调整,避免返回空文本,或者使用“选择性粘贴”后,再配合“查找和替换”功能,将空文本替换为真正的空白。 另一种高级场景是数组公式。在旧版Excel中,数组公式需要按Ctrl+Shift+Enter三键输入,其结果显示方式与普通公式不同。如果您只复制了数组公式结果区域中的一部分进行粘贴,很可能会导致错误或显示异常。正确的做法是选中整个数组公式输出的区域进行复制,然后在目标区域选择相同大小的范围,再进行“选择性粘贴为数值”。在现代Excel(Office 365或2021版)中,动态数组函数(如FILTER、SORT)已大大简化了这一过程,但其结果的复制粘贴仍需注意目标区域是否有足够的溢出空间。 外部链接和跨工作簿引用也是潜在的“坑”。如果您的公式引用了其他工作簿中的数据,例如“=[预算.xlsx]Sheet1!$A$1”,那么当您复制这个公式到新位置,并且目标工作簿没有打开或路径改变时,公式可能会返回错误或显示旧值。在这种情况下,粘贴前最好先将公式转换为本地值。使用“选择性粘贴为数值”可以一劳永逸地解决外部链接带来的显示和更新问题。 对于追求效率的用户,可以探索“粘贴值”的快捷方式。除了之前提到的快捷键,您还可以考虑将“粘贴值”功能添加到“快速访问工具栏”。方法是点击文件->选项->快速访问工具栏,在“从下列位置选择命令”中选中“所有命令”,找到“粘贴值”(可能显示为“粘贴值”或“值和源格式”等),点击“添加”>>,然后确定。之后,您只需要点击工具栏上的这个图标,就能一键完成粘贴值的操作。 在共享和协作环境中,保护工作表也可能导致粘贴问题。如果目标工作表或单元格被设置为“锁定”并启用了工作表保护,您可能无法直接粘贴内容,或者粘贴操作被限制。这时需要联系工作表的所有者获取编辑权限,或暂时取消保护(如果有密码)。 最后,一个经常被忽视的细节是“剪贴板”面板本身。您可以打开“开始”选项卡->剪贴板组右下角的小箭头,调出剪贴板窗格。它记录了您最近复制或剪切的内容。有时,直接从剪贴板窗格点击某项进行粘贴,可能会与右键粘贴的行为略有不同。确保您从剪贴板粘贴时,选择的也是“值”而非其他格式。 总结来说,面对“excel公式后怎么复制粘贴的内容不显示”这一挑战,我们的应对策略是一个系统的诊断和操作流程:首先明确需求,是要动态公式还是静态结果;其次,优先使用“选择性粘贴为数值”来获取稳定结果;然后,检查并统一源单元格和目标单元格的数字格式;接着,排查公式是否返回了特殊结果(如空文本、错误值);对于复杂公式(如数组公式、跨簿引用),采取针对性的复制粘贴策略;并善用快捷键和自定义工具栏提升操作效率。通过理解Excel底层的数据和格式逻辑,您就能从被动地解决问题,转变为主动地驾驭工具,让数据真正为您所用,清晰、准确地呈现在每一张报表中。
推荐文章
当用户询问“excel公式自动计算方法是什么类型的数据”时,其核心需求是想了解在微软的Excel(Microsoft Excel)中,能够被公式自动识别、引用并进行运算的数据具体有哪些种类,以及如何确保数据格式正确以触发自动计算。本文将从数据类型、格式设置、计算原理及常见问题等多个维度,提供一份详尽的指南,帮助用户彻底掌握相关知识,从而高效利用Excel的自动化计算功能。
2026-03-03 22:52:30
311人看过
Excel公式自动计算的过程,本质上是用户输入以等号开头的表达式后,程序按特定顺序解析公式中的运算符与函数,依据单元格引用获取数据,并遵循严格的运算优先级进行连续计算,最终将结果动态显示在单元格中的一系列自动化处理流程。理解这个过程,有助于用户更高效地编写公式和排查计算错误。
2026-03-03 22:50:32
88人看过
当你在excel公式后怎么复制粘贴文字内容时,核心需求通常是将公式计算的结果作为纯文本值固定下来,避免因引用单元格变化而改变。这可以通过选择性粘贴功能,将公式结果转换为数值或文本,或者使用复制后右键菜单中的“粘贴为值”选项来实现,确保数据独立且稳定。
2026-03-03 22:48:55
40人看过
当您在Excel中遇到公式计算式自动计算结果不对时,这通常意味着存在数据格式、公式引用、计算设置或函数使用等方面的潜在问题。解决这一困扰需系统排查,从检查单元格格式与数据一致性入手,并关注计算选项、引用方式及循环引用等关键环节。通过本文提供的多维度深度解析与实操方案,您将能有效诊断并修正错误,确保计算结果的准确性。
2026-03-03 22:48:52
186人看过
.webp)

.webp)
.webp)